Question
- the top of a fire escape ladder must reach a window ledge 14 ft above the ground. the ladder is positioned so its length along the slope is 20 ft. how far from the building base should the ladder rest on the ground?
Step1: Identify right triangle sides
Let $c=20$ ft (ladder, hypotenuse), $a=14$ ft (height, vertical leg), $b$ = horizontal distance (unknown). Use Pythagorean theorem: $a^2 + b^2 = c^2$.
Step2: Rearrange to solve for $b$
$b^2 = c^2 - a^2$
Step3: Substitute values
$b^2 = 20^2 - 14^2 = 400 - 196 = 204$
Step4: Calculate square root
$b = \sqrt{204} = 2\sqrt{51} \approx 14.28$ ft
